Document images are usually degraded in the course of photocopying, faxing, printing, or scanning. Degradation problems seems negligible to human eyes but can be responsible for an abrupt decline in accuracy by the current generation of optical character recognition (OCR) systems. In this paper we present binarization method based on retinex theory followed by a global threshold. High quality results in terms of visual criteria and OCR performance is produced compared to the previous works.
